Apple trees like warm and humid environment and are suitable for planting in fertile and loose soil rich in organic matter. Pay attention to drainage and ventilation. Apples are planted in the north and south of China. Generally, the most famous producing areas are Yan 'an, Yantai, Jingning, Lingbao and Zhaotong, among which the red Fuji varieties in Yantai are the most famous.

Apple growth rate
The growth process of apple must go through flowering, physiological fruit drop, fruit expansion and maturity. From bud to fruit harvest, the apple fell four times. The first time is at the end of flowering, and the second time is one week after flowering, lasting 5~20 days, that is, early fruit dropping. The third time is 7~ 14 days after the last fruit drop, which is also called physiological fruit drop. The fourth time is just before the fruit is harvested, that is, before the fruit is harvested.
